Suability Meaning in Urdu

The meaning of Suability in Urdu is "قابلیت دعوی" as written in Urdu script, or "Qabliyat daawa" as written in Roman Urdu. Other possible Urdu translations for Suability include "Qabliyat daawa". You can find more definitions and synonyms of Suability on this page.

Suability Definition & Meaning in English
  1. (n.) Liability to be sued; the state of being subjected by law to civil process.
